Abstract :
In this paper, we characterize a printed loop antenna at high frequency (HF). The low-cost printed antenna will be used in a HF RFID smart shelf system for a low cost solution. The performance of the printed antenna is compared with an antenna made of PCB (copper) at 13.56 MHz in terms of impedance matching, field response, Q-factor, and detection range. The investigation is carried out by experiments.
